titleOfInvention | Sheet-shaped waterproof material and method of construction |
abstract | (57) [Summary] [PROBLEMS] To provide excellent mechanical properties such as waterproofness, followability to a base material, load resistance, abrasion resistance, etc., as well as paint adhesion, It has additional properties such as root protection, chemical resistance, long-term durability, etc., and can respond to safety and environmental pollution at the construction site, and can exhibit basic performance in a short time, and It does not require skilled work such as impregnation work, and it can be easily installed even on complicated surface structures such as uneven surfaces, corners, corners, etc. Provide a new waterproof lining material that can eliminate the occurrence. SOLUTION: This is a sheet-like waterproof material including a curable molding material layer containing a curable resin and an adhesive layer, wherein the curable resin is a cured product obtained by curing the curable resin. A sheet-like waterproof material having an elongation of 20 to 200%. |
